Subject: SproutSync scheduler — staging cutover

Team,

The GreenGauge plant-watering scheduler is frozen for the 4.2 release. Cron windows moved to 15-minute granularity; your webhook payloads now include zone_id. Validate against staging before Thursday or we slip the partner launch. Regression suite is green on our side. Flag blockers to Priya on the Fernwell channel.

Use the token below for staging auth.

bearer token for tawig-bahif: eyJhbGciOiJIUzI1NiIsInR5cCI6IkpXVCJ9.eyJzdWIiOiIo-yiO33jvEIn0.T9qLInSAqhTN

**Ticket: Replica lag alarm firing on Pondmere staging — config drift suspected**

Hey, flagging this before the release train leaves: the read-replica lag alarm on Pondmere staging has been firing all morning, but the replica looks healthy. Pretty sure someone hand-tuned the threshold in prod last quarter and staging never got the update, so the two environments have drifted apart. Can you hold the cut until we reconcile? Current staging alarm settings are below.

deployment values, yadup-kadug:
[sorys]
port = 5672
team = noveth
host = sorys.orvexcorp.example
region = south-4
access_code = ac_deddc1
timeout_ms = 1500

Hi, and welcome to the rotation! Quick heads-up for plugin authors: the Stockline reconciliation job runs nightly at 02:00 and will quarantine any plugin that reports counts outside its declared tolerance. If your plugin gets quarantined, it's usually a schema mismatch, not a bug in the job. Retry steps and the tolerance config reference live on the page below.

runbook for badug-kadup: https://confluence.zemvarlabs.internal/projects/browse/display/projects/bd1b

## Onboarding: The Stringharvest Extraction Script

Welcome to the Polyglot Tools team. Stringharvest is our script that walks the Wrenlet codebase and extracts translation strings into locale bundles. Run it locally before your first PR so you understand the output format; never edit generated bundles by hand. The script signs each bundle, and signing requires access to the team's locked credentials store. On your first run you'll be prompted to restore that store — when asked, enter the recovery passphrase provided directly below.

strongbox words: istwyn-normir-silwyn-ulaius-istwyn